It covers five issues: human creation and the idea of a single soul; marital roles, specifically 河顎姻a稼ic verse 4:34 and womens status in a marriage; Mary, mother of Jesus; womens legal testimony; and 河顎姻a稼ic ideas of modesty, specifically of veiling. A chapter is devoted to each of these topics, comprising classical, medieval, modern, and contemporary interpretations of these verses. All chapters include various Muslim perspectives, such as Sunni, Twelver Shia, Ismaili, Ibadi, and Sufi; with the exception of the chapter on Mary, each chapter also includes interviews with contemporary scholars, namely amina wadud, Sadiyya Shaikh, Fariba Alasvand, Yusuf Saanei, and Nasser Ghorbannia.
